﻿ #ingresoCV h2{color:#900;margin-bottom:10px;}.leyendaRequerido{margin:6px 0;}#ingresoCV caption{color:#900;font-weight:bold;text-align:left;}.formGeneral label span,.formGeneral li span.tituloSubSeccion,#ingresoCV label span,#ingresoCV li span.tituloSubSeccion{float:none;}.formGeneral .datoLargo label,#ingresoCV .datoLargo label{float:none;}.formGeneral .datoLargo span,#ingresoCV .datoLargo span{float:none;display:block;}.formGeneral .datoLargo label span,#ingresoCV .datoLargo label span{display:inline;}#ingresoCV table{margin-bottom:20px;clear:left;}.formGeneral .datoCorto label,#ingresoCV .datoCorto label{float:none;}.formGeneral .datoCorto span,#ingresoCV .datoCorto span{float:none;}.formGeneral .datoGrupoRadio label,.formGeneral .datoGrupoRadio span,#ingresoCV .datoGrupoRadio label,#ingresoCV .datoGrupoRadio span{float:none;}.formGeneral li span.tituloSubSeccion,#ingresoCV li span.tituloSubSeccion{display:block;}.tabladespliegueDatos{width:100%;}.tabladespliegueDatos,.tabladespliegueDatos th,.tabladespliegueDatos td{border:none;text-align:left;}.tabladespliegueDatos th{border-bottom:2px solid #999;}.tabladespliegueDatos td{border-bottom:1px solid #E4E4E4;}.tabladespliegueDatos .celdaAccion{width:80px;text-align:center;}#identidadUsuario{float:left;width:100%;margin:0 0 10px 0;}#identidadUsuario .fotocv{float:left;width:150px;margin:0 10px 0 0;}#identidadUsuario h1{float:left;font-size:1.5em;}#vistaCVgeneral h2,#col-p #vistaCVgeneral h2{clear:both;background:#DBDBDB;color:#000;padding:4px 8px;font-size:1.2em;margin:0;}#vistaCVgeneral table{width:100%;margin:10px 0;}#vistaCVgeneral th,#vistaCVgeneral td{padding:4px 4px;}#vistaCVgeneral th{width:30%;text-align:right;border-right:1px solid #DBDBDB;}#vistaCVgeneral td{width:70%;}.tools-vista-cv{margin-top:10px}